Skip to content

Commit c92cfe4

Browse files
committed
fix #73
1 parent 1b4747c commit c92cfe4

File tree

3 files changed

+4
-4
lines changed

3 files changed

+4
-4
lines changed

Example/SJMediaCacheServer/SJViewController.m

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
#import <SJVideoPlayer/SJVideoPlayer.h>
1212
#import <Masonry/Masonry.h>
1313

14-
static NSString *const DEMO_URL_FILE = @"https://xy2.v.netease.com/2024/0705/64ba5c013ee90db19d399f0255ab9103qt.mp4";
14+
static NSString *const DEMO_URL = @"http://devimages.apple.com/iphone/samples/bipbop/bipbopall.m3u8";
1515

1616
@interface SJViewController ()
1717
@property (nonatomic, strong, nullable) SJVideoPlayer *player;
@@ -37,7 +37,7 @@ - (void)viewDidLoad {
3737
}
3838

3939
- (IBAction)play:(id)sender {
40-
NSURL *playbackURL = [SJMediaCacheServer.shared proxyURLFromURL:[NSURL URLWithString:DEMO_URL_FILE]];
40+
NSURL *playbackURL = [SJMediaCacheServer.shared proxyURLFromURL:[NSURL URLWithString:DEMO_URL]];
4141
_player.URLAsset = [SJVideoPlayerURLAsset.alloc initWithURL:playbackURL startPosition:0];
4242
}
4343
@end

SJMediaCacheServer.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@
88

99
Pod::Spec.new do |s|
1010
s.name = 'SJMediaCacheServer'
11-
s.version = '2.0.1'
11+
s.version = '2.0.2'
1212
s.summary = <<-DESC
1313
SJMediaCacheServer 是一个高效的 HTTP 媒体缓存框架,旨在代理媒体数据请求并优先提供缓存数据,从而减少网络流量并增强播放的流畅性。该框架支持两种类型的远程资源:基于文件的媒体,如 MP3、AAC、WAV、FLAC、OGG、MP4 和 MOV 等常见格式,以及 HLS(HTTP Live Streaming)流。它会自动解析 HLS 播放列表并代理各个媒体片段。
1414
DESC

SJMediaCacheServer/Core/Prefetch/HLSPrefetcher.m

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-67,7 +67,7 @@ - (instancetype)initWithURL:(NSURL *)URL
6767
}
6868

6969
- (NSString *)description {
70-
return [NSString stringWithFormat:@"%@:<%p> { URL: %@, prefetchSize: %lu, prefetchFileCount: %lu, progress: %f };\n", mURL, NSStringFromClass(self.class), self, (unsigned long)mPrefetchSize, (unsigned long)mPrefetchFileCount, self.progress];
70+
return [NSString stringWithFormat:@"%@:<%p> { URL: %@, prefetchSize: %lu, prefetchFileCount: %lu, progress: %f };\n", NSStringFromClass(self.class), self, mURL, (unsigned long)mPrefetchSize, (unsigned long)mPrefetchFileCount, self.progress];
7171
}
7272

7373
- (nullable id<MCSPrefetcherDelegate>)delegate {

0 commit comments

Comments
 (0)